"The Little House in the Fairy Wood" by Ethel Cook Eliot is a timeless classic of children's literature, seamlessly blending elements of fantasy and fairy tale to create an enchanting narrative. Eliot's tale unfolds in a magical realm filled with woodland creatures and mystical beings, inviting readers into a whimsical world of adventure and enchantment. Through vivid descriptions and evocative imagery, Eliot captures the essence of childhood imagination, transporting readers to a fairyland where anything is possible. At its heart, the story celebrates the power of friendship and the boundless potential of the human imagination. As the protagonist embarks on a journey through the magical realm, encountering challenges and forging new friendships along the way, readers are swept away on a captivating adventure that inspires wonder and awe. "The Little House in the Fairy Wood" is a classic tale that continues to delight readers of all ages with its timeless charm and universal themes. Eliot's masterful storytelling and imaginative world-building make this book a beloved favorite for generations, reminding us of the magic that exists all around us, if only we have eyes to see.
